
Wild Arms: Twilight Venom
This anime is based on a PlayStation game under the same title. The story is about four people who travel the desolated land of Filgaea and carve themselves a legendary story while they`re at it. These adventurers are Sheyenne Rainstorm, a gunslinger who holds the legendary weapon called ARMs; Kiel Aromax, a scientist who looks like he should be carrying a sword; Roleta Oratorio the Crest Sorceress, a magic-user who uses cards called Crests to cast spells; and Mirabelle Graceland, one of the Noble Red, which are a family of vampiric creatures who live alongside human beings They also travel with cute little intelligent furry things, from the Popepi Pipepo Tribe, named Isaac and Jerusha.

Wild Arms: Twilight Venom has 22 episodes.
As of now, Wild Arms: Twilight Venom has finished.
Wild Arms: Twilight Venom aired from October 18, 1999 to March 27, 2000.
Wild Arms: Twilight Venom is a TV series with episodes around 20 minutes long, originally from Japan.
Wild Arms: Twilight Venom premiered in Fall 1999.
